The CO2SINK Integrated Project aims at in-situ testing of geological storage of CO2 in a saline aquifer. A field laboratory is developed with one injection well and two observation wells (50 m and 100 m distance). Focus of the project is on monitoring the fate of the injected CO2 using a broad range of geophysical, geochemical and microbiological techniques. Injection of CO2 in a depth of approximately 650 m started end of June 2008 and arrival has been determined in the nearer observation well as expected and predicted after an amount of 531 t CO2.
